Why Northwest Chile Dominates Solar Energy Production
The Atacama Desert, often called the "sunniest place on Earth," receives over 3,000 hours of annual sunlight. For photovoltaic glass manufacturers, this translates to:
- 30% higher energy output compared to global averages
- Reduced land costs due to vast arid areas
- Proximity to copper mines (critical for solar component wiring)

Photovoltaic Glass Innovations Driving Efficiency
Modern manufacturers combine Chile's natural advantages with cutting-edge technology. For instance:
- Anti-reflective coatings that boost light absorption by 8%
- Self-cleaning surfaces reducing maintenance costs
- Thin-film designs cutting material use by 40%
But here's the kicker: these innovations aren't just for solar farms. Architects now integrate photovoltaic glass into skyscrapers and residential windows – a trend accelerating in Santiago's urban renewal projects.
Overcoming Challenges in Desert Manufacturing
Operating in Northwest Chile isn't all sunshine. Manufacturers face:
- Dust accumulation reducing panel efficiency
- High-temperature durability requirements
- Logistics in remote locations
EK SOLAR tackled these through robotic cleaning systems and partnerships with local universities. Their adaptive glass coatings withstand 50°C+ temperatures – a game-changer for tropical markets eyeing Chilean tech.
Industry Forecast: 2024–2030
Chile aims to generate 70% of its electricity from renewables by 2030. For photovoltaic glass producers, this means:
- 15% annual growth in utility-scale projects
- Rising demand for hybrid solar-wind storage systems
- Government tax incentives for export-oriented manufacturers
Did You Know? Chile exports solar components to 14 countries, with Peru and Colombia being top buyers of photovoltaic glass.
